As a side note: A 400-watt HPS luminaire initially supplies about 50,000 lumens. The rule of thumb is to reduce the HPS lumen output by half to determine the LED lumen output, which would be 25,000 lumens in this case.
How many watts does a 400 watt metal halide use?
In fact, a 400 watt MH light actually consumes 452 watts, due to the ballast factor. In actuality, the 50 400 watt lights consume 22,600 watts of power each hour, or 22.6 kilowatt hours ( kWh) of hydro each hour.

Are LED lumens the same as metal halide lumens?
Metal Halide lights have average efficiency (75-100 lumens/watt source efficiency). They lose out to LEDs principally because their system efficiency is much lower (<30 lumens/watt) due to all of the losses associated with omnidirectional light output and the need to redirect it to a desired area.

Does metal halide need ballast?
Metal halide (MH) ballasts are required to start the lamp, regulate the lamp starting and lamp operating currents, and provide appropriate sustaining supply voltage.

What is the maintenance rate of a luminous flux?
The luminous flux maintenance rate is the ratio of the luminous flux of the light used for a period of time to the initial luminous flux of the light. L70 means that the luminous flux has decayed to 70% of the original luminous flux, L80 means that it has decayed to 80% of the original luminous flux, and L90 means that it has decayed to 90% of the original luminous flux.

What is the ANSI code for a metal halide ballast?
Generally speaking, there is an ANSI code on the ballast. The ballast of the metal halide light starts with M, followed by 2 or 3 codes, for example: “M59” means a 400W ballast.

How many lumens does a 400 watt light bulb need?
For older 400 watt bulbs (10+years), you would only need 12,000 to 14000 lumens. For fixtures about 3-10 years old, look for 14,000 to 18,000. However, if you opt to go brighter than that, or to replace 1-2 year old bulbs, look for LED Lights that produce 18,000 to 20,000 lumens. Remember to focus on lumens not watts.
How many lumens do I need to replace a 400 watt LED bulb?
How many lumens do i need to replace a 400 watt metal halide with LED? A: To replace a 400 watt Metal Halide you will need abotu 18,000 lumens. This can range from 16,000 lumens if you are replacing at the end of the metal halide life to as high as 25,000 lumens for a brand new bulb. Metal halide lose a lot of light over its 5000 hour life.

How does age affect metal halides?
This is due to the fact that metal halide loses a lot of light over time. In the first 2 years, they lose 30% of their efficiency. In the first 5 years, 50% light is lost and this figure rises up to 75% in 10 years.
